Output 963064d1b87f839f28d95f6f106d66865ec9ed4a3e9f72594a3ea8745c93c7db:1

value
28649300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9052ff23b3f3ca12f951257f7179dae07a2de2b OP_EQUAL
address
3Nw7afCgoPChtEbfJT2AqGs24x1uqJoKdt
transaction
963064d1b87f839f28d95f6f106d66865ec9ed4a3e9f72594a3ea8745c93c7db
spent
true